English: Leipzig/Saxony, Mädlerpassage: 360°×180° spherical panorama of the Mädlerpassage near the north entrance with the stairs to Auerbachs Keller and the two bronze figure groups "Mephistopheles bewitching the students" and "The students bewitched by Mephistopheles" by Mathieu Molitor (from 1912 / 1913) - the Mädlerpassage is a cultural monument;
